Carnival, Arison family donate $2m to Hurricane Harvey relief

Carnival Cruise Line, parent company Carnival Corp. and the Micky and Madeleine Arison Family Foundation have stepped up to help disaster relief and recovery efforts
Carnival Cruise Line, Carnival Corp. & plc and the Micky and Madeleine Arison Family Foundation are pledging at least $2m to relief and rebuilding efforts in the Gulf Coast following Hurricane Harvey.

The devastating storm was the first Category 4 hurricane to make landfall in the US since 2004.

Carnival Cruise Line and Carnival Foundation, the philanthropic arm of Carnival Corp., are each donating $500,000 to Harvey disaster relief efforts, for a total donation of $1m from the company. Carnival Corp. chairman Micky Arison and wife Madeleine are matching the corporation's commitment with a $1m donation from the Micky and Madeleine Arison Family Foundation.

To generate additional funding passengers sailing on certain Carnival Cruise Line voyages will have the option to make a donation when they check in for their cruise, while the corporation's brands and employees will be participating as well.

'Our hearts go out to all those who have been impacted by the devastation of Hurricane Harvey and its aftermath, and all of us throughout the Carnival Corporation family feel a responsibility to do our part in supporting relief and rebuilding efforts in a region that we call home and where so many of our guests and business partners live and work,' Carnival Cruise Line president Christine Duffy said.

'We know this storm is still active,' she added, 'so we will continue to hold positive thoughts for everyone in the region while exploring ways to support affected communities as they recover and rebuild.'

Carnival is working with emergency response authorities, community leaders and key relief and recovery organizations to identify the most urgent needs and immediate allocations for the donated funds.

The donation will help provide families with access to food, shelter, water, hygiene products, general necessities, medicines and healthcare supplies.
